Ethylene Furnace Automation, Control & Optimization
Jim Cahill
Pete Sharpe Author: Pete Sharpe Cracking furnaces are one of the most crucial parts of an ethylene complex. They set the production and yield for the entire plant. For furnace-limited plants, when a furnace is down, whether for maintenance or decoking, production is lost. Poor control and sub-optimal furnace operations lead to lower yields, more frequent decoke cycles, increased energy costs, and higher health,…

Encouraging Greater STEM Career Participation
Jim Cahill
Science, Technology, Engineering and Math (STEM) careers are common here at Emerson. Our company published a study this year that found : …that 6 out of 10 Americans are interested in pursuing STEM careers – but fewer than 4 in 10 (39%) have felt encouraged to do so. The disparity is even more pronounced among women: 2 out of 3 U.S. women say they were not encouraged to pursue a career in STEM. Sue Ooi Emerson supports…

Agile Project Methodology for the Right Types of Projects
Jim Cahill
The concept of Agile for managing software projects began in the 1990 in software development under early forerunners such as “ …Scrum, DSDM, Application Development and Extreme Programming “. The waterfall project management method was causing growing lead times and lack of flexibility to make changes later in the project as more was learned along the way.
